Which of the following has more mass (grams)?

A. 1 mole of hydrogen atoms.
B. 1 mole of helium atoms.
C. 1 mole of neon atoms.
D. 1 mole of carbon atoms.

Final answer:

1 mole of neon atoms has the most mass, with approximately 20.18 grams, compared to 1 mole of hydrogen (1.00 g), helium (4.00 g), and carbon (12.00 g).

Step-by-step explanation:

The mass in grams of 1 mole of an element can be determined by its atomic weight. Given the choice between 1 mole of hydrogen atoms, 1 mole of helium atoms, 1 mole of neon atoms, and 1 mole of carbon atoms, we can determine which has more mass (grams) by comparing their molar masses.

  • Hydrogen (H) has an atomic mass of approximately 1.00 g/mol.
  • Helium (He) has an atomic mass of approximately 4.00 g/mol.
  • Carbon (C) has an atomic mass of approximately 12.00 g/mol.
  • Neon (Ne) has an atomic mass of approximately 20.18 g/mol.

Therefore, 1 mole of neon atoms has the greatest mass, approximately 20.18 grams.
